cloud Partner

Alibaba Cloud

The HashiCorp effort to provision, secure, run, and connect any application on any infrastructure extends to providers worldwide. The partnership with Alibaba Cloud is another step towards offering a product suite that supports organizations transitioning their infrastructure into the cloud on a global scale. Alibaba Cloud is a quickly growing provider of public cloud infrastructure and tools like Terraform provide simplicity while creating and managing, single, multi, or hybrid cloud environments. As the collaboration with Alibaba continues and grows to cover new services, HashiCorp will provide the workflows to adopt these technologies.

Website

Integration

How Alibaba Cloud works with HashiCorp Product Suite

Provision Infrastructure

Operators moving into the cloud face three unique challenges: addressing infrastructure heterogeneity, managing scale, and enabling self service consumption across organizations. To address these challenges for users adopting Alibaba Cloud, HashiCorp offers a dedicated Terraform provider for the purpose of provisioning and managing Alibaba cloud-based services. Users can write configurations using infrastructure as code, check them into version control, version them, and run a few commands to test and apply changes to their Alibaba infrastructure.

Terraform Integrations for Alibaba Cloud:
Terraform Provider
Terraform Modules

Additional Resources:
IaC - Terraform Solution
Deploy Container Service clusters using Terraform

Get Started with Terraform
Read Documentation

Secure Secrets

Vault secures, stores, and tightly controls access to tokens, passwords, certificates, encryption keys for secrets and other sensitive data using a UI, CLI, and HTTP API.

Get Started with Vault
Read Documentation

Run Applications

Nomad is a flexible, enterprise-grade cluster scheduler that can run a diverse workload of micro-service, batch, containerized and non-containerized applications. Nomad's lightweight architecture and zero external dependencies minimize operational overhead in any on-prem or public cloud environment. Nomad Enterprise adds collaboration and governance capabilities, allowing organizations to run Nomad in a multi-team setting and meet governance and policy requirements. Users on Alibaba Cloud are able to provision Nomad to run workloads on Windows based machines with or without another platform.

Get Started with Nomad
Read Documentation

Connect Applications

Consul is a service mesh offering for discovering, securing, and configuring services across any infrastructure. Consul clusters allow agents to talk across data centers to provide health monitoring, K/V storage, and a variety of other services. To create these clusters, Consul relies on the creation of agents that assume either a server or client role and join an existing cluster upon startup. To help prevent failures in cluster formation, Consul users utilizes the command "retry-join" provisioned for Alibaba Cloud. This instructs agents to join the first private IP of a server with a given tag and key value and authorized via a secret key.

Consul Integrations for Alibaba Cloud:
Alibaba Cloud Auto Retry

Get Started with Consul
Read Documentation